Background technology
Elastomeric material of the refractory material as heat-insulation and heat-preservation, is widely used in the construction applications of high-temperature industrial furnace liner. Since refractory material focuses on the technical requirements of construction when construction is built by laying bricks or stones, so current is that work progress uses manually more The mode of manual working.There are the defects of several respects during artificial construction, first cannot be overall there are the uniformity of construction quality Ensure;Second has that speed of application is slow, efficiency is low;The 3rd extraordinary construction site such as fluidized-bed combustion boiler, which exists, to be entered Construction area is difficult, and the factor such as operation side danger, easily occurs construction operation security incident.Inventor obtains employment according to itself Experience, has merged the construction requirement of each details step of a variety of refractory materials, has manufactured and designed full automatic construction equipment, with its gram Take above-mentioned technical problem.

As shown in Figure 1, a kind of moldable reinforcing shaping equipment for the formula shape damage that can prevent from caving in, including material-pulling device and beat Expect device.Material-pulling device is pushed to required position by moldable, and consolidation can be beaten by moldable by then beating material device.
Material-pulling device includes two groups of pusher function groups, and two groups of pusher function groups longitudinally stack arrangement.Pusher function group includes Pusher coaster, pusher slide and coaster power set, pusher coaster can be under the drivings of coaster power set along pusher slide Move back and forth.Pusher coaster includes pusher sleeve, pusher cylinder, connecting plate and shovel board, and material-pulling device is installed on by pusher cylinder In pusher sleeve, shovel board is installed on pusher sleeve by connecting plate, when coaster power set push to pusher coaster between pusher When in gap, shovel board can scoop up moldable on supporting plate, and then pusher cylinder drives material-pulling device will be moldable in shovel board Push to and pile up position.Each workbench can be with the function group of independently working as one, and adjacent two groups of function groups are in longitudinal direction It is vertically arranged.Material-pulling device promotes the structure of shovel board to realize the work purpose back and forth transmitted using cylinder.
Blowing device is arranged on the top of pusher coaster, and blowing device includes air pump, appendix and gas nozzle, and gas nozzle passes through appendix Air pump is connected, gas nozzle can make the reduction of its humidity to moldable blowing.The drying operation of appropriateness can turn plastic refractory During movement is defeated, it will not cause to stick together in conveying device or material-pulling device because of surface tackiness.
Beating material device includes hammer stem and tup two parts, and hammer stem drives tup to act on the surface of plastic refractory.In hammer stem Gas storage tank and pulse air delivery device are set, three vertical bar slots is opened up on tup, sliding block is fixed in vertical bar slot;In vertical bar Sliding hammer is set in slot, limit sliding chutes are opened up in sliding hammer, sliding block is arranged in limit sliding chutes, and sliding block is along vertical bar slot and spacing cunning Slid in both grooves.When sliding hammer is inserted into vertical bar slot, combustion gas space is retained between the insertion end and vertical bar slot of sliding hammer, when When sliding hammer is moved into vertical bar slot, combustion gas space is compressed, and is mixed after next step is passed through combustion gas, is compressed in combustion gas empty Interior setting automatic ignitor, occurs detonation after the mixed gas of automatic ignitor initiating compression.Combustion is opened up in vertical bar slot Tracheae jack, one end connection Gas Pipe of Gas Pipe jack, the other end unicom combustion gas space of Gas Pipe jack, for by combustion gas Be delivered to designated position, Gas Pipe stretches into hammer stem and connects gas storage tank by pulse air delivery device, gas storage tank as Source of the gas.
Pulse air delivery device includes circular orbit, and the section of circular orbit is " U "-shaped.Circular orbit is by the first vertical bar track, One arc track, the second vertical bar track and the second arc track tandem array are composed.Three are set on the first vertical bar track " u "-shaped magnetic clamp more than a, " u "-shaped magnetic clamp from outside block the first vertical bar track and each " u "-shaped magnetic clamp it Between be placed equidistant with, the first vertical bar track clamp " u "-shaped magnetic clamp position at place magnet ball group, each magnet ball group bag Include the magnet ball of more than three.The device further includes push rod device, for used in starter, push rod device to include Rotary power unit, slider-crank mechanism and push rod, rotary power unit connect push rod by slider-crank mechanism, dynamic in rotation Under the drive of power apparatus, push rod is driven by crank block slider structure, realizes front and rear reciprocal operation, push rod is inserted into the first vertical bar rail Road inscribe and the second arc track are tangent, by hitting starter during stretching, treat that device resets after retraction and just run again.The Deceleration salient point is set on the inner wall bottom surface of two arc-shaped guide rails, using integral ring-shaped Track desigh, is opened in initial position using push rod Dynamic operation, by acceleration twice or more than twice, makes Magnetic force ball pass sequentially through each push type break-make device, buffers one section Afterwards, into being provided with the bend of deceleration salient point, finally resetted in the first magnetic force point, back and forth run above-mentioned action and complete work mesh 's.
Several push type break-make devices, the quantity of push type break-make device and the number of Gas Pipe are set on the first arc track Measure identical.Push type break-make device includes gas-guide tube, and gas-guide tube is horizontally installed in the first arc track, before every Gas Pipe includes Hold Gas Pipe and rear end Gas Pipe, one end unicom combustion gas space of front end Gas Pipe, the other end connection air guide of front end Gas Pipe Manage and gas storage tank is connected by gas-guide tube unicom rear end Gas Pipe, rear end Gas Pipe, be consequently formed the fuel gas path of closure. Break-make hole is set at the middle part of gas-guide tube, and the lower part in break-make hole sets spring cavity, sets resetting spring in spring cavity, in break-make hole Break-make valve body is inserted into, gas port is set on break-make valve body, resetting spring jacks up break-make valve body to upper limit under original state, leads to Disconnected valve body can close air guide pipe choking, when the lower pressure that the magnet spherical zone that break-make valve body top is rolled comes, break-make Valve body overcomes the elastic force of resetting spring to push, and gas port is located in gas-guide tube, makes gas-guide tube be in unimpeded state.
Moved when push rod is promoted away from its first nearest magnet ball along the first vertical bar guide rail, and with first " u "-shaped magnetic Inhale the magnet ball group at clamp to bump against, last magnet ball of the magnet ball group at first " u "-shaped magnetic clamp is subject to magnetic After power accelerates, bump against with the magnet ball group at second " u "-shaped magnetic clamp, the magnet ball at second " u "-shaped magnetic clamp After last magnet ball of group is subject to magnetic force to accelerate, bump against with the magnet ball group at the 3rd " u "-shaped magnetic clamp ... ..., And so on, until last magnet ball of last group of magnet ball group scrolls through the second arc track, make the second arc Each push type break-make device sequential batch break-make of track, makes gas supply form the mode of pulsed supply, finally then One magnet ball warp crosses the second vertical bar guide rail and the second arc-shaped guide rail reaches the initial end of the first vertical bar guide rail, is added again by push rod Speed.Device utilizes operation of the magnetic ball in predetermined trajectory, to drive the operation of next station, is accelerated at the same time by magnetic force repeatedly Realize the pulsatile effect of next station.
Equipment further includes magnetic force control device, and the bar shaped magnetic that magnetic force control device includes being arranged on inside circular orbit is slided Rail, the magnetic force adjustment sliding block of more than three is set on bar shaped magnetic slide, and magnetic force adjustment sliding block can be moved along bar shaped magnetic slide.When When magnetic force adjustment sliding block is close to " u "-shaped magnetic clamp, it can increase to the attraction of magnet ball at the " u "-shaped magnetic clamp, so that Magnet ball is made mutually to collide the acceleration bigger of acquisition.By setting corresponding bar shaped to magnetize rail in the inside of circular orbit, Realize the adjusting to magnetic force of each magnetic force point itself, can be with indirect control magnetic force acceleration by the control to magnetic force point magnetic force Effect, what is thus directly affected is the change of pulse frequency.
Equipment further includes combustion gas safety control valve, and combustion gas safety control valve includes leakage sensor and rotating disc type valve body, leakage Gas sensor can perceive in tup and hammer stem whether have gas leakage.Rotating disc type valve body is linked into the Gas Pipe of front end, works as leakage Gas sensor has perceived gas leakage, and the rotation of rotating disc type valve body can be made to block the combustion gas transmission of front end Gas Pipe.Turntable Formula valve body includes interior valve disc, outer valve disc and valve disc rotary power unit, coaxially pacifies in interior valve disc insertion in valve disc and with interior valve disc Dress, is opened in the identical valve opening of front end Gas Pipe quantity on inside and outside valve disc, and is accessed by valve opening in the Gas Pipe of front end Portion, interior valve disc connection valve disc spins power set can simultaneously be driven by valve disc rotary power unit to be rotated, the valve on inside and outside valve disc When hole site correspondence communicates, front end Gas Pipe is in access device, when the valve opening position on inside and outside valve disc is staggered, front end combustion Tracheae is in off state.Rotating disc type valve body is coordinated by sensor, to may after the long-time service caused by the tup portion that leaks Divide and carry out fuel gas shutoff, to ensure the safe operation of complete equipment.Rotating disc type valve body realizes more gas circuits by inside and outside valve disc Simultaneously close off, during normal operation, because being designed in device for more gas circuits, corresponding valve opening pair can be equipped with corresponding inside and outside valve body Gas circuit is connect, once there is danger, inside and outside valve body rotates immediately under the drive of valve disc rotating mechanism, and each valve opening is directly carried out Dislocation operation, to cut off fuel gas pipeline.
